Heat pump replacement services involve removing an outdated or malfunctioning heat pump system and installing a new unit to ensure efficient heating and cooling. The process typically includes disconnecting the existing equipment, preparing the installation site, and properly setting up the new heat pump to operate correctly within the property’s HVAC system. Professionals focus on ensuring the new unit is correctly sized for the property’s needs and that it integrates seamlessly with existing ductwork or electrical connections. This service aims to provide a reliable and energy-efficient heating and cooling solution for the property owner.

Replacing a heat pump can address several common issues, such as frequent breakdowns, declining efficiency, or inadequate heating and cooling performance. Older systems may consume more energy, leading to higher utility bills, or fail to maintain consistent indoor temperatures. Upgrading to a new heat pump can improve indoor comfort, reduce energy costs, and eliminate the inconvenience of ongoing repairs. Replacement Cost Range - The cost to replace a heat pump typically falls between $3,500 and $7,500, depending on the unit size and efficiency. For example, a standard residential system in San Bruno might cost around $5,000. Variations in equipment and installation complexity can influence the final price.

Labor Expenses - Labor costs for heat pump replacement generally range from $1,500 to $3,500. Factors such as existing ductwork and system complexity can affect the overall labor charges. Local pros provide estimates based on specific project requirements.

Additional Costs - Additional expenses may include permits, which can add $200 to $500, and optional upgrades like advanced thermostats or zoning systems. These extras can influence the total project budget and should be considered during planning.

Cost Factors - The final cost varies with the size of the heat pump, brand, and installation conditions. Larger or high-efficiency units tend to be more expensive, and local service providers can provide tailored estimates for specific needs. Variations are common across different projects.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

How do I know if my heat pump needs to be replaced? Signs such as frequent breakdowns, reduced heating or cooling efficiency, or increasing energy bills may indicate the need for a replacement. Consulting with local heat pump service providers can help determine the best course of action.

What are the benefits of replacing a heat pump? Replacing an outdated or inefficient heat pump can improve energy efficiency, reduce operational costs, and ensure reliable heating and cooling performance with the help of local professionals.

How long does a heat pump replacement typically take? The duration varies depending on system complexity and site conditions, but local service providers can provide an estimate after assessment.

Are there different types of heat pumps available for replacement? Yes, options include air-source, ground-source, and ductless models, with local pros able to recommend suitable choices based on specific needs.
